I always loved the idea of being able to draw, but I never imagined how deeply it would change my life. In this video, I share 10 surprising ways that drawing has transformed my everyday experiences, my travels, my problem-solving, and even my stress levels.

This isn’t just about making pretty pictures—it’s about seeing the world differently and connecting with it in new ways. If you’re curious about how picking up a sketchbook can impact your life, join me on this journey.
